  1. POBug in MVC3 - requests never time out. Works fine for aspx pages in same project
    text
    copied!<p>I'm seeing this on our production site as well as a small test site I setup just to test this out...</p> <p>Basically, it appears that requests handled by mvc never time out. I've set an executionTimeout in my web.config and turned off debug mode. I've then added an infinite loop of thread.sleeps to both a regular aspx page and an mvc page (the loop is in the controller of the mvc page). The aspx page reliably times out (HttpException (0x80004005): Request timed out.), but the mvc page just spins forever without timing out.</p> <p>Are there separate settings for mvc (I've looked but haven't found them)? Do mvc requests not timeout by default?</p> <p>Any help on this would be appreciated.
